Key elements affecting costs.
Damaged roof replacement in Orange, CT, involves removing the existing roofing materials and installing new components to restore the roof’s integrity. Understanding the typical scope and factors involved can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.
- Materials used may include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, depending on homeowner preferences and building requirements.
- The size and complexity of the roof, including pitch and number of layers, influence the overall scope of the replacement project.
- Labor considerations include the removal of old roofing, installation of new materials, and potential structural adjustments, which can vary in complexity.
- Permitting requirements in Orange, CT, generally involve local building codes and inspections to ensure compliance with safety standards.
- Additional services such as roof ventilation, flashing replacement, or gutter updates may be included as extras in the project scope.
